Scope and content
Two letters from Christopher Challis:
(a) typescript, two pages on two folios (recto only), dated 3 June 2005, concerning IS's draft chapter on the English coinage of 1526-1544 for his book. He expresses concern about the absence of footnotes and the "highly selective bibliography", which perhaps suits specialised scholars but takes little account of the needs of the general reader coming to the material for the first time. He also feels that the "lists of weights, finenesses and outputs" and calendar are unnecessary. CEC then focuses on particular points, enumerating twelve of them.
(b) typescript, single page, dated 16 June 2005, regarding IS's draft chapter on Debasement, 1542-1551. CEC reiterates his concerns about the lack of footnotes and complete bibliography before enumerating twelve specific points.
